`Pursuant to 37 C.F.R. §42.64(b)(1), the undersigned, on behalf of Patent
`
`Owner Arendi S.A.R.L. (“Arendi” or “Patent Owner”) hereby submits the
`
`following objections to Exhibit 1012 and Exhibit 1002, which were attached to the
`
`Petition for Inter Partes Review.
`
`Ex. 1012 is objected to as not having been authenticated as required by
`
`Federal Rule of Evidence 901 or 902. Ex. 1012 is further objected to on the
`
`grounds that it is irrelevant in the absence of an established publication date. Ex.
`
`1012 is further objected to on the grounds of hearsay. Ex. 1012 is further objected
`
`to for failure to establish that the document has ever been published.
`
`In Ex. 1002, paragraph 32 (except for its first sentence) is objected to for
`
`presenting inadmissible evidence after its first sentence. This paragraph seeks to
`
`enter evidence from inadmissible Ex. 1012 without authenticating the exhibit,
`
`without laying a proper foundation, without establishing a publication date and
`
`thus without demonstrating relevance.
`
`These objections are being timely served within 10 business days of the
`
`institution of the present inter partes review trial.
